Known as Pluto’s Gate, the famous “Gate to Hell” cave was celebrated as the portal to the underworld in Greco-Roman mythology and tradition. It was said to be located in the ancient Phrygian city of Hierapolis, now called Pamukkale, and described as filled with lethal mephitic vapors.
